Senior Java разработчик
Занятость | Полная занятость |
Полная занятость | |
Адрес | Узбекистан, Ташкент |
Описание вакансии
HamkorLab — Business Unit HamkorBank, одного из крупнейших банков Республики Узбекистан, который разрабатывает и выводит на рынок современные цифровые продукты для миллионов пользователей.
Мы — большая команда профессионалов из разных стран мира, влюбленных в своё дело и объединённых общей целью - создать лучшие онлайн финансовые сервисы для клиентов.
Мы в поиске Senior Java-разработчика.
Основные обязанности:
- Поддержка и разработка серверных приложений ДБО ЮЛ на Java.
- Согласование и проработка архитектуры проекта ДБО ЮЛ.
- Анализ и разработка технической документации, включая концепции, схемы и описания архитектуры.
- Проведение технического консалтинга интегрирующихся систем и выработка оптимальных архитектурных решений по интеграции системами-потребителями.
- Детальное проектирование сервиса (СУБД/back/front/API) с учетом требований безопасности, отказоустойчивости, времени отклика и т.п.
- Разработка бэкэнд-части высоконагруженной системы.
- Разработка интеграционных сервисов и микросервисных компонентов.
- Рефакторинг и оптимизация кода, code review.
- Участие в тестировании разработанных компонентов и исправлении дефектов.
- Участие в принятии архитектурных решений и исследовательских задачах.
- Участие в разработке и согласовании API front-back.
- Взаимодействие с разработчиками, дизайнерами и другими командами.
- Наставничество, развитие технической экспертизы в команде.
Что мы ожидаем от тебя:
- Опыт работы в роли разработчика от 6 лет в проектах по разработке и/или модификации и/или внедрению ПО с использованием инструментов и технологий Java.
- Опыт работы со всеми указанными технологиями по направлению Java: Spring, Hibernate, SQL, Gradle\Maven, Git, Jenkins, Docker, Kubernetes, Openshift, Postgres.
- Знание протоколов и технологий безопасности (SAML, OAuth, OpenID Connect, SCIM, WebAuthn).
- Опыт работы с каталогами идентификаций (Active Directory, LDAP).
- Понимание принципов информационной безопасности и требований к данным.
- Опыт командной разработки с использованием программных продуктов Bitbucket, Confluence и Jira.
- Опыт работы, как в каскадных (waterfall), так и в гибких методологиях (Agile и/или Scrum) разработки.
Что мы в свою очередь предлагаем:
-
Профессиональная команда, где каждый сотрудник - неотъемлемая часть успеха;
-
Работа с перспективными продуктами для миллионов пользователей;
-
Использование современных технологий и подходов к процессу разработки;
-
Формат работы: офис/гибрид/удаленка.
Требования
Опыт | Более 6 лет |
Условия работы
График работы | Удаленная работа |
Добавлено 3 дня назад
Пожаловаться